Ascent Media Strengthens Global Operations Leadership With Two Key Additions

Ascent Media Group, LLC (Ascent Media) today announced it has appointed David Walters to Senior Vice President of Global Technical Operations and Infrastructure, and Eric Denna to Senior Vice President of Global Process Design. Walters and Denna will be based at Ascent’s Santa Monica offices and report directly to Douglas Parrish, EVP Operations.

Walters will be responsible for architecture and deployment of global infrastructure, specifically focusing on networks, content storage, and enterprise computing. Along with his team, Walters will ensure Ascent Media’s infrastructure properly supports the diverse needs of its businesses and operates with the highest availability and reliability, while maintaining optimal cost and reducing the overall use of resources.

Denna will lead Ascent Media’s Global Process Design team and help further streamline and simplify media service delivery by defining and implementing successful business processes, production workflows, and system tools that will allow the company to operate more cost-efficiently, at scale, and at an even-higher level of quality.

“The addition of David and Eric to our team greatly strengthens our global operations leadership,” said Douglas Parrish, EVP Operations of Ascent Media Group. “The combination of their expertise in information technology and business processes will be invaluable in implementing cost-efficient programs that will help further strengthen our global reach while reinforcing our commitment to best address our customers’ growing needs worldwide.”

Most recently, Walters served as Vice President of Technical Operations at Walt Disney Company’s Internet division where he was in charge of the engineering, building and ongoing management of hosting environments for Disney’s Internet services; ABC, ESPN, Online Parks and Resorts, and other Disney online branded products. Walters also worked with Microsoft in London, UK, and Redmond, WA, holding a variety of roles in product development, systems engineering and management. He was part of the early product development efforts for Microsoft’s Enterprise BackOffice Suite, and joined the MSN Product Development organization close to the inception of the commercial Internet.

Prior to Ascent Media, Denna worked with Ernst & Young, Price Waterhouse, and Coopers & Lybrand. He also served as Chief Information Officer for Times Mirror Corporation, for Brigham Young University, and for The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-Day Saints. He was associate professor of information systems at BYU’s Marriott School of Management. Denna, who has written five books and several scholarly and professional articles on the strategic use of information technology, holds a PhD in Information Systems from Michigan State University and a master’s degree in information systems from BYU.

About Ascent Media Group

Santa Monica, California-based Ascent Media Group, LLC is a wholly-owned subsidiary of Ascent Media Corporation (NASDAQ: ASCMA). With more than 40 facilities worldwide, Ascent Media Group is a leading provider of fully integrated, end-to-end services for the global digital media supply chain. Guided by our entrepreneurial culture, we blend breakthrough creative with emerging technologies to deliver some of the most advanced and innovative media solutions to help film and television studios, independent producers, broadcast networks, cable channels, advertising agencies and other companies make, manage, move and monetize their digital media.
